What Are Stone Waterproofing Agents?
Stone waterproofing agents are specially formulated products designed to create a protective barrier on stone surfaces. These agents penetrate the stone, forming a **water-repellent layer** that effectively keeps moisture out. Commonly used in both indoor and outdoor applications, they are essential for maintaining the appearance and structural integrity of stone surfaces.
These agents come in various forms, including **sealants, sprays, and solutions**, each catering to specific types of stone and user needs. They are typically made from polymer-based compounds, silanes, or siloxanes, which bind to the stone's surface and create a hydrophobic layer.
Benefits of Using Waterproofing Agents
Investing in quality stone waterproofing agents can yield numerous benefits:
1. Enhanced Durability
By repelling water, stone waterproofing agents prevent damage caused by freeze-thaw cycles, which can lead to cracking and spalling. This significantly enhances the **lifespan of your stone surfaces**.
2. Stain Resistance
Moisture can lead to mold, mildew, and stains from organic materials. Waterproofing agents create a barrier that minimizes the absorption of these substances, keeping your surfaces clean and aesthetically pleasing.
3. Cost-Effective Protection
While there is an upfront cost associated with applying waterproofing agents, they can save you money in the long term by reducing the need for repairs and replacements due to damage.
4. Easy Maintenance
Waterproofed surfaces are easier to clean and maintain. Dirt and debris are less likely to adhere to the stone, making routine upkeep simpler.
5. Improved Aesthetic Appeal
Waterproofing agents can enhance the natural color and texture of stone surfaces, providing a **vibrant appearance** that can improve property value and curb appeal.
Types of Stone Waterproofing Agents
There are several types of stone waterproofing agents available, each with its unique properties and applications:
1. Penetrating Sealers
These sealers sink into the stone to provide deep protection. They are ideal for porous stones like limestone and sandstone.
2. Surface Sealers
Surface sealers form a protective layer on top of the stone, providing excellent stain resistance but may alter the stone's appearance.
3. Natural Stone Enhancers
These products enhance the stone's natural color while providing waterproofing benefits. They are often used on decorative stone surfaces.
4. Impregnating Sealers
Impenetrating sealers are designed to allow the stone to breathe while still providing a robust barrier against moisture. They are perfect for exterior applications.
Application Techniques for Waterproofing Agents
Proper application of stone waterproofing agents is crucial for ensuring their effectiveness. Here are some general steps to follow:
1. Surface Preparation
Ensure the stone surface is clean, dry, and free of any debris, oils, or old sealants. Use a power washer or a stiff brush with soap and water for cleaning.
2. Choosing the Right Tool
Depending on the type of waterproofing agent, you can use a **sprayer, brush, or roller** for application.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ions for the best results.
3. Application
Apply the waterproofing agent evenly, starting from one corner and working your way across the surface. Ensure complete coverage, especially in porous areas.
4. Drying Time
Allow the agent to cure as per the manufacturer’s recommendations. Avoid using the surface until fully dry to ensure maximum protection.
Maintenance and Care of Waterproofed Surfaces
After applying stone waterproofing agents, regular maintenance is essential to prolong their effectiveness:
1. Regular Cleaning
Keep the surface clean by using mild detergents and soft brushes. Avoid harsh chemicals that could degrade the waterproofing layer.
2. Reapplication Schedule
Depending on the type of waterproofing agent used, you may need to reapply the product every few years. Regular inspections can help determine when reapplication is necessary.
3. Avoid Heavy Loads
Limit the weight placed on waterproofed surfaces, especially during the initial curing period, to prevent any potential damage.
Common Misconceptions About Waterproofing Agents
Despite their effectiveness, some misconceptions surround stone waterproofing agents:
1. Waterproofing Agents Make Stone Slippery
Many assume that waterproofing makes surfaces slippery. However, proper products are designed to maintain traction while providing protection.
2. All Waterproofing Agents Are the Same
Not all waterproofing agents suit every stone type. Always select a product tailored for your specific stone material.
3. Waterproofing Is Only for Exterior Surfaces
While outdoor surfaces benefit significantly, indoor surfaces can also benefit from waterproofing, especially in high-moisture areas like kitchens and bathrooms.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How often should I reapply stone waterproofing agents?
Reapplication frequency varies based on the product and environmental conditions, but generally, every 1-3 years is advisable.
2. Can I use waterproofing agents on all types of stone?
Not all waterproofing agents are suitable for every stone type. Always check the product specifications.
3. Do waterproofing agents change the color of the stone?
Some products may enhance or alter the color. It’s best to opt for enhancers for a more natural look.
4. Is waterproofing necessary for indoor stone surfaces?
Yes, especially in areas prone to moisture, such as kitchens and bathrooms.
5. What should I do if my stone surface is already damaged?
Conduct necessary repairs before waterproofing to ensure effective protection.
